Cedar Siding Staining in Boulder, CO
Cedar siding staining services involve applying protective and decorative stains to cedar exteriors to enhance their appearance and extend their lifespan. This service is suitable for a variety of projects, including restoring faded or weathered cedar siding, accentuating architectural features, or maintaining the natural beauty of cedar materials. Homeowners typically seek cedar siding staining to improve curb appeal, protect against moisture and UV damage, and preserve the wood’s integrity over time.
Before requesting cedar siding staining, property owners often want to understand the current condition of their siding, including whether it requires cleaning, sanding, or repairs prior to staining. It’s also helpful to consider the type of stain best suited for their specific cedar siding, whether transparent, semi-transparent, or solid, based on desired aesthetics and durability. Proper preparation and choice of stain can significantly influence the longevity and appearance of the finished project.

Cedar Siding Staining Questions
What is cedar siding staining? Cedar siding staining involves applying a protective and aesthetic finish to cedar exteriors, enhancing appearance and longevity.
Why should homeowners consider cedar siding staining? Staining helps preserve the wood, prevents weather damage, and maintains the home's curb appeal.
How often is cedar siding staining recommended? It is generally advised to stain cedar siding every 3 to 5 years to keep it protected and looking its best.
What factors influence the choice of stain for cedar siding? The type of stain, color preference, and the siding’s exposure to weather are key considerations for selecting the right product.
